Commit graph

  • aa9ef96804 remove unused mut master Moritz Eigenauer 2025-11-20 11:11:25 +01:00
  • 711569b8e5 send uci info Moritz 2025-11-20 10:20:56 +01:00
  • d5b679b6bf update progress Moritz 2025-11-20 00:22:18 +01:00
  • a127815cad lazy move generation Moritz 2025-11-20 00:19:35 +01:00
  • a93bfe258c restructure Moritz 2025-11-19 22:05:37 +01:00
  • 2e5f6e3d7d update progress Moritz 2025-11-19 11:35:46 +01:00
  • 6c5e92aade increased tt size to 4GB Moritz 2025-11-19 11:33:40 +01:00
  • 05dc19925c update progress Moritz 2025-11-19 10:44:27 +01:00
  • 42816a6939 implemented transposition table Moritz 2025-11-19 10:40:41 +01:00
  • ea9419d7e0 update progress Moritz 2025-11-18 20:54:30 +01:00
  • b69323665c integrated material eval into psqt Moritz 2025-11-18 20:14:47 +01:00
  • 7b84e8a0ab update progress Moritz 2025-11-18 17:03:04 +01:00
  • ecf1de6c6a iterative deepening Moritz Eigenauer 2025-11-18 15:19:30 +01:00
  • 0c1055d7aa fixed eval wrong table orientation Moritz Eigenauer 2025-11-18 13:03:52 +01:00
  • 32be42e283 piece square evaluation Moritz Eigenauer 2025-11-18 11:44:36 +01:00
  • 4a8e1ce52c fix checkmate search Moritz Eigenauer 2025-11-17 10:52:15 +01:00
  • 6b280c35bb progress Moritz 2025-11-17 08:32:19 +01:00
  • c6c12145e4 progress Moritz 2025-11-17 08:31:42 +01:00
  • e62ed41521 alpha beta pruning Moritz 2025-11-17 08:29:17 +01:00
  • a18f22bcc5 alpha beta pruning Moritz 2025-11-17 08:26:06 +01:00
  • bc4d1dc865 .\.git\ Moritz 2025-11-17 08:25:15 +01:00
  • 391a08ad88 alpha beta pruning Moritz 2025-11-16 20:49:24 +01:00
  • eb19606360 alpha beta pruning Moritz 2025-11-16 20:18:44 +01:00
  • 96ea7fd2c9 fixed progress tracking Moritz 2025-11-15 18:42:56 +01:00
  • e66771dba9 performance progress tracking Moritz 2025-11-15 18:30:21 +01:00
  • f1ec0a08d9 fixed uci Moritz 2025-11-15 11:43:03 +01:00
  • 66cea5a2bf basic uci protocol Moritz 2025-11-15 01:04:03 +01:00
  • 9d527634eb most basic best move search Moritz 2025-11-14 23:32:52 +01:00
  • af2178abad fixed perft Moritz 2025-11-14 22:30:42 +01:00
  • e3edb21111 debug Moritz Eigenauer 2025-11-14 18:45:41 +01:00
  • 196e5ba265 added (failing) perft, debugging required Moritz 2025-11-14 13:56:49 +01:00
  • 2aca5ed841 prevented illegal castling Moritz 2025-11-14 12:16:55 +01:00
  • 2a100c8b50 completed is_square_attacked testing Moritz 2025-11-14 11:20:44 +01:00
  • e305a3556f implement is_square_attacked and is_king_attacked Moritz 2025-11-13 22:59:26 +01:00
  • 1ddc38165f added undo_move, added make/undo testing Moritz 2025-11-13 16:47:34 +01:00
  • e7578dd0f0 cleanup and restructure Moritz 2025-11-13 15:47:32 +01:00
  • 5e19c1e494 finished make_move Moritz 2025-11-13 14:47:43 +01:00
  • b72e1e55eb implemented make_move for basic white moves Moritz 2025-11-13 01:06:33 +01:00
  • ca75fa6d61
    Delete mistake Moritz Eigenauer 2025-11-13 00:03:13 +01:00
  • 628b9fcc42 syncing between desktops Moritz Eigenauer 2025-11-12 18:19:21 +01:00
  • 1f61dc35f8 reworked moveflag system Moritz Eigenauer 2025-11-12 18:09:51 +01:00
  • 951a8bbec6 Reinitialize repository and add working move generation for all pieces Moritz Eigenauer 2025-11-12 17:01:12 +01:00